Since Saturday, Adeline has taken all of her feedings by mouth - either via bottle or nursing.  She is doing great and has developed a routine of eating every 3 hours and napping in between.  She has continued to gain weight, and weighs 1950 grams, which is a little over 4 lbs, 4 oz.  Because she has done so well with feedings, she has graduated from an isolete to a crib! 


Her temperature is monitored every 3 hours to make sure she can regulate her body temperature in the open crib, and she needs to continue to gain weight.  Once she has proven she can do this for a few days, she just has a few more tests to do and then she can come home!  They will do a hearing screening (done on all newborns in VA), a carseat test (to make sure she can breathe properly in the slumped position in her carseat), and some other routine medical tests.  We are still on track for her to come home sometime around this weekend.
